geometry
ge.om.e.try \je--'a:m-*-tre-\ n [ME geometrie, fr. MF, fr. L geometria, fr. Gk geo-metria,] often attrib fr. geo-metrein to measure the earth, fr. geo-- ge- + metron measure - more at MEASURE 1a: a branch of mathematics that deals with the measurement, properties, an d relationships of points, lines, angles, surfaces, and solids 1b: a particular type or system of geometry 1c: a treatise on geometry 2a: CONFIGURATION 2b: surface shape 3: an arrangement of objects or parts that suggests geometrical figures
